How we calculated this

We compared this property's assessed value per square foot ($268/sqft) against the median for the neighborhood ($149/sqft). This property is assessed 79.3% higher than typical homes nearby.

If the appraisal district adjusted the value to the neighborhood median, the owner could save approximately $7,350 per year in property taxes based on the Harris County effective tax rate.

In this neighborhood, 25% of protests resulted in a reduction, with a median reduction of $65,054.
